Forensic Computing: Unveiling the Cybercrime Trail

In the digital age, cybercrime has become a pervasive risk, demanding innovative solutions to combat its ever-evolving nature. Forensic computing emerges as a vital discipline, providing investigators with the tools and techniques to analyze digital evidence and reconstruct criminal activity within the virtual realm.

Specialists in forensic computing possess a deep understanding of operating systems, network protocols, and data layouts. They meticulously examine computer systems, memory cards, and network logs to uncover hidden clues and establish a timeline of events.

Via advanced software and click here forensic methodologies, they can recover deleted files, identify malicious code, and trace the origins of cyberattacks. This meticulous analysis provides invaluable insights to law enforcement agencies, enabling them to apprehend perpetrators and bring justice to victims.

Incident Response: Swift Action in a Cyber Crisis

In the ever-evolving landscape of cyber threats, swift and decisive measures are paramount. A well-defined framework serves as the cornerstone for effective crisis management. When a cyberattack occurs, time is of the essence. Organizations must be prepared to assess the severity of the threat and implement mitigation strategies promptly. This requires a coordinated team between security analysts, IT personnel, and leadership.

A robust incident response plan should encompass several key phases: preparation, detection and analysis, containment and eradication, recovery, and post-incident review.

Every phase holds a critical role in minimizing damage, restoring services, and learning for future attacks.

Regular exercises are essential to ensure that all stakeholders understand their roles and responsibilities during a crisis.

{Ultimately,{ incident response is a continuous cycle that demands vigilance, adaptability, and a commitment to cybersecurity best practices.

Detecting and Defending Against Advanced Persistent Threats

Advanced persistent threats (APTs) present a significant challenge to organizations of all sizes. These sophisticated cyberattacks are launched by skilled adversaries who penetrate networks with the objective of acquiring sensitive information or impairing critical systems.

To effectively detect and defend against APTs, organizations must implement a multi-layered security strategy that encompasses robust technical controls, intensive security policies, and well-trained personnel.

Preventive measures such as network segmentation, intrusion detection systems (IDS), and vulnerability scanning can help to identify and mitigate potential threats before they widen. Regular security audits and penetration testing can also reveal vulnerabilities in an organization's defenses.

Furthermore, organizations should foster a culture of security awareness among employees, providing in-depth training on best practices for identifying and reporting suspicious activity. By taking a holistic approach to cybersecurity, organizations can significantly reduce their vulnerability to APTs and protect their valuable assets.
